我是NodeJ的新手,我曾经使用过C#
Console.ReadLine();
我查看了“ readline”和节点提示包,但输入时两次输出所有用户输入,或者使用“ terminal:false”选项,不允许我们使用退格键。
答案 0 :(得分:0)
有一个阅读行,您可以像这样使用它:
const readline = require('readline');
const rl = readline.createInterface({
input: process.stdin,
output: process.stdout
});
rl.question('How are you today? ', (answer) => {
// TODO: Log the answer in a database
console.log(`Thank you for your valuable feedback: ${answer}`);
rl.close();
});
文档可用here。
答案 1 :(得分:0)
var stdin = process.openStdin();
stdin.addListener("data", function(d) {
console.log("your input: " + d.toString());
});
这就像您获取输入值